Subject: DR drill recap — FD leak hunt

Team,

Thursday's disaster-recovery drill on Pinemast focused on the leaked-file-descriptor hunt in the relay tier. We confirmed the lsof sweep script catches leaks within two cycles, and failover to the Ostermere cluster completed in under four minutes. One gap: restoring the relay's encrypted state store requires the recovery passphrase, which several responders couldn't locate. To close that gap, it is recorded below for the sync notes.

recovery phrase for bawep-kawef: oliath-casdor

Hey Marisol — the retention sweeper on Dustbin Prime stopped purging stale records last night because its service credential expired over the weekend. Nothing's broken yet, but the backlog will blow past quota by Thursday if we don't rotate before the release cut. I've already minted a replacement through the Keysmith console, so just drop it into the sweeper's config. The new key is as follows.

gateway credential: zpat7_4Y3Gskp

## Waveform Preview — Environment Variables

Hey release manager! The ChirpTrace waveform preview service renders those little audio squiggles on track pages. It mostly configures itself, except the render farm token, which must be set per release train — the old one dies when you cut a new tag. Don't copy it from last cycle's notes; generate fresh. Once generated, drop this line into the production env file before shipping.

vault entry, yahif-yajep: COURIER_KEY29=b802bdf8034096b65a51c6ba5abe2